This is default 1.28E in which the the numbers of special events and special missions are not zero so their tabs are active.
Scrolling down to special mission #2 has seven of the possible eight targets listed in green boxes.
Clicking on one of these green boxes will bring up the map, with the appropriate radio button selected, so that a new target can be selected if necessary.

Please note that on most pages there is a green "Enter these changes" button. Clicking it not only puts the numbers in the grid, but writes them into the file. Editing takes place "on the fly".
I have deliberately left the grids visible so that we can see the actual values.
I may produce another version with an editing checkbox. This would let the changes to the grid be made, but allow the user the option to write to the file.
